image text in transcribedLT Company is a manufacturer of body and hand lotions. Each product is produced in a separate production department. Three support departments are involved in providing support to the production department: utilities, general plant, and purchasing. The budgeted data for the five departments is as follows: Service Depatments Production Depatments Utilities General Plant Purchasing Body Lotion Hand Lotion Overhead Square feet Machine hours Purchase order Allocation base RM120,000 3,000 1,233 20 Machine hours RM540,000 1,000 1,403 40 Square feet RM220,000 3,000 1,345 7 Purchase order RM137,500 9,600 8,000 60 Machine Hours RM222,500 8,400 24,000 120 Machine Hours The production department's overhead rate is based on machine hours. Body lotion uses 3 machine hours per kilogram, while hand lotion uses 1.5 machine hours per kilogram. Required: a) Calculate the overhead cost per kilogram for each product using the overall factory overhead rate. b) Prepare an overhead allocation schedule to the production department using the direct method. c) Calculate the overhead cost per kilogram for each product by using the departmental rate allocated in b) above.
